Delivery Note and Inbound delivery are one and the same. Based on the Shipping Notification received from the Vendor we create Inbound delivery in the system. Delivery note contains the Qty despatched by the Vendor. Pro-forma Invoice is a concept used in Sales and is similar to a billing d...

In shipping, it is important to note that the estimated time of delivery (ETD) is from the port of origin and the estimated time of arrival (ETA) is to the port of destination. ETD and ETA do not mean that it is from the shipper’s premises to the consignee’s doorstep unless mentio...
